Recognizing Defense Strategies



Understanding the various protection strategies your attorney might utilize is important to effectively browsing your situation. Each technique depends upon the specifics of the fees you're encountering and the proof versus you. Allow's explore what you need to understand.

To begin with, if there's an absence of evidence, your legal representative could suggest that the prosecution hasn't met its burden of proof. Bear in mind, it's not your work to show innocence; it's the prosecutor's job to prove sense of guilt past a practical doubt. If they can't, you should be acquitted.


An additional usual technique is self-defense, particularly in cases entailing charges like assault or homicide. If you were securing on your own, your attorney may utilize this approach to justify your activities legitimately. This requires proving that your perception of risk was reasonable and that your reaction was proportional to that risk.

Lastly, your attorney may bargain an appeal deal if it serves your benefit. This generally takes place if the proof against you is solid however there are minimizing factors that might cause decreased charges or sentencing.

Comprehending these approaches assists you discuss your situation more effectively with your attorney.
